Hydraulic Drilling Equipment
Hydraulic drilling equipment is a powerful and versatile type of machinery used in construction, mining, geothermal projects, water well installation, and geotechnical exploration. It is designed to perform drilling operations by using hydraulic power to drive the main working components, such as the rotary head, feed system, and lifting mechanism. Compared with mechanical or pneumatic drilling systems, hydraulic drilling equipment offers greater control, higher efficiency, and more stable performance in demanding working environments.One of the main advantages of hydraulic drilling equipment is its strong power output. The hydraulic system converts fluid pressure into mechanical force, allowing the machine to drill through soil, rock, gravel, and other challenging formations with precision. This makes it suitable for a wide range of applications, from shallow foundation work to deep borehole drilling. The ability to deliver consistent torque and thrust also helps improve drilling speed and reduce energy loss during operation.Another important feature is its flexibility. Hydraulic drilling equipment can be adapted for different drilling methods, including rotary drilling, percussion drilling, and core drilling. Depending on the project requirements, operators can choose different drill bits, rods, and accessories to achieve the desired results. This adaptability makes the equipment useful in many industries and terrains, including urban construction sites, remote mining areas, and rugged mountainous regions.Hydraulic drilling equipment is also valued for its precise control. Operators can adjust rotation speed, pressure, feed force, and drilling depth more accurately than with many other types of drilling machines. This level of control is especially important in geotechnical investigations and foundation engineering, where accurate sampling and borehole quality are critical. Modern hydraulic systems often include user-friendly control panels, monitoring instruments, and safety devices that help improve operational reliability and reduce the risk of errors.Durability is another key benefit. These machines are built with reinforced frames, high-strength drilling components, and advanced hydraulic parts that can withstand heavy-duty use. In harsh environments, such as areas with high dust, moisture, or extreme temperatures, hydraulic drilling equipment is designed to maintain stable performance. Regular maintenance of hydraulic oil, filters, hoses, and seals is essential to keep the equipment operating efficiently and to extend its service life.In addition, hydraulic drilling equipment can improve productivity and reduce labor intensity. Automated or semi-automated functions, such as mast lifting, rod handling, and pressure adjustment, help operators complete tasks faster and with less physical effort. This not only increases work efficiency but also enhances workplace safety by reducing manual intervention in dangerous drilling conditions.In conclusion, hydraulic drilling equipment is an essential tool for modern drilling projects. Its combination of power, precision, adaptability, and durability makes it suitable for a broad range of applications. As technology continues to advance, hydraulic drilling machines are expected to become even more efficient, intelligent, and environmentally friendly, supporting the growing demands of engineering and resource development.

Land drilling rigs are core integrated mechanical equipment specially designed for onshore oil and gas exploration, well drilling, workover and completion operations, fully manufactured and inspected in accordance with API 4F, API 7K, API Q1 and ISO 9001 international industry standards. As the most essential equipment in onshore petroleum engineering, the land drilling rig undertakes multiple core functions including rock breaking, rotary drilling, tripping pipe, casing running and mud circulation, covering full-range working conditions from shallow wells, medium wells, deep wells to ultra-deep wells. It is widely applied in conventional oil and gas fields, tight oil, shale gas, coalbed methane, geothermal wells and cluster well development projects in plain, mountain, desert and plateau regions.
